The development of in vitro culture solutions also played an important role within the establishment of ESCs. Evans pioneered the usage of irradiated chick embryo fibroblasts as feeder cells to culture mammalian stem cells in vitro, which enabled the upkeep and expansion of pluripotent stem cells (PSCs)19. Dependant on these conclusions, Evans, Kaufman, and Martin productively derived mouse ESCs (mESCs) in the ICM of blastocysts, marking the beginning of contemporary stem cell research20,21.

Nearly all analysis to this point has made usage of mouse embryonic stem cells (mES) or human embryonic stem cells (hES) derived in the early interior cell mass. Both of those contain the critical stem cell features, nonetheless they demand very diverse environments in an effort to preserve an undifferentiated point out. Mouse ES cells are grown with a layer of gelatin as an extracellular matrix (for help) and need the stemcell presence of leukemia inhibitory factor (LIF) in serum media.
